BETTY D. BURNETTE
October 25, 1929 – January 3, 2013


LOUISBURG – Betty Davenport Burnette, 83, of Louisburg, died Thursday evening. 

Betty was a daughter of the late James and Mary Brickhouse Davenport.  She was preceded in death by her husband, Robert H. Burnette, and 3 sisters and 6 brothers.  Betty was the owner of Burnette’s Retirement Village for over 40 years.

She is survived by her daughters and sons-in-law, Mary Gray B. Patterson, Becky B. and Elwood Leonard, Betsy B. and Jimmy Hunt, all of Louisburg; brother and sister-in-law, Stancil and Barbara Davenport of Nashville; 7 grandchildren, Mandy Patterson, Jonathan Patterson, Cory Leonard and wife Pam, Jennifer Wingo and husband Brad, Marti Garrett and husband John, Jamey Hunt and wife Ashley, and Lacey Hunt; 3 great-grandchildren.

A funeral service will be held 4 p.m. Sunday at Sandy Creek Baptist Church with the Rev. Joel Story officiating. Burial will follow in the church cemetery.
